Hello Everyone, Happy Friday! It is time to preview set 2 of 3, of the upcoming flat ride library.

Last week we presented

Sky Whirl, Super Round Up, Giant Sky Chaser, Bumper Cars (exterior), Intamin 1st Generation Freefall, KMG Experience, and Bumper Boats. This week's batch contains more custom backer requests, including a unique custom backer design of a variation of a Condor with hydraulic arms.

This 2nd set includes

Chance Wipeout, Chance Turbo, Classic Coney Island Ride, Hay Baler, Custom Backer Design (Condor variation), steerable Bumper Cars (interior), and Zamperla Tea Cups We also just finished adding audio to all the rides. One of our favorites was the 1st Generation Intamin Freefall. From start of the ride, up the elevator, and down the drop we used recordings from the ride, which makes the riding experience very immersive. We hope you enjoy it and all the rides coming your way soon! Next Friday we will be back previewing set 3, which will include steerable Go Karts, Zamperla Backflash (which takes advantage of our specialized physics based animation solution), Rotoshake, and more!
